A quorum is the minimum number of members of an organization required to transact business in a meeting. If there is no quorum at a meeting, then votes cannot be taken at that meeting.
Such a number of the officers or members of any body as is competent by law or constitution to transact business; as, a quorum of the House of Representatives; a constitutional quorum was not present.

Typically a quorum is more than half of the members. By-laws often state that a quorum must be present to legally conduct business or hold a meeting. Most often a quorum will be a majority, anything over 50%, however, the organization by-laws may state some other percentage to be a quorum.
A majority of U.S. Senators constitutes a quorum to do business. The size of the U.S. Senate, barring vacancies, has been 100 since 1959. A majority of 100 is at least 51.
